Labor safety refers to the rules and regulations that ensure a safe and healthy working environment for employees. It helps prevent injuries, accidents, and health issues while ensuring compliance with health and safety laws.
In Georgia, labor safety is regulated by the Organic Law on Labor Safety: 🔗 Link
This law defines the rights, obligations, and responsibilities of government agencies, employers, employees, and other individuals in the workplace to ensure a safe and healthy work environment.
Businesses must follow health and safety laws and labor safety standards to provide a secure workplace and prevent legal violations.
Labor safety instructions outline the rules and requirements for protecting employees during work processes. These instructions are tailored to specific job tasks and help reduce risks and prevent accidents.
A labor safety certificate is an official document that proves an individual is qualified to plan and manage workplace safety measures to prevent violations of health and safety laws.

Industries with high occupational health risks have specific labor safety regulations, including:
- Construction
- Manufacturing and chemical industries
- Mining and mineral extraction
- Transport and logistics
- Energy sector
- Healthcare and medical industry
Construction labor safety regulations ensure the protection of workers' health and safety. The construction industry involves high-risk activities such as working at heights, mechanical hazards, heavy equipment use, and fire risks. Special safety measures are required to prevent accidents.

Environmental Impact Assessment
Proper environmental documentation helps minimize negative environmental impacts and prevents government-imposed fines or business shutdowns. This ensures compliance with Environmental Impact Assessment (EIA) regulations.
Environmental impact permits are regulated by Georgia’s Environmental Impact Assessment (EIA) Code, document number 890IIს: 🔗 Link
An EIA report analyzes the environmental impact of a project or business activity. It helps prevent negative effects by implementing appropriate mitigation measures.
